FELON ARRESTED FOR POSSESSING FIREARMS

08/29/2013


Gilberto Jabiel Salinas

     On August 23rd at approximately 9:42 PM, Sheriff’s Deputies responded to 31 Woodhaven Lane near Gassville on a report of gunshots being fired in the area.  Upon arrival at the residence, deputies made contact with 29 year old GILBERTO JABIEL SALINAS.  Deputies inquired of SALINAS about the reported gunfire.  SALINAS replied he knew nothing about gunfire and that there were no firearms in the residence. 

     At this point, deputies could visually see a loaded magazine for a pistol in plain view.  An NCIC inquiry revealed SALINAS to be a convicted felon from the State of Texas and thereby prohibited from possessing firearms.  He was at the residence alone. 

     Deputies later found several firearms and some ammunition inside the residence.  These were identified as:

  • ·         Walther P99 9mm pistol with two magazines
  • ·         Springfield XP-5 .45 cal ACP pistol with two magazines
  • ·         Palmetto PA15, .223 cal rifle (AR-15 type) with four magazines
  • ·         ID INC USA 7.62x39 cal rifle (SKS type)
  • ·         182 rounds of ammunition
  • ·         Eight (8) spent 9mm cartridges

     These firearms and ammunition were seized and taken into evidence.  GILBERTO JABIEL SALINAS was arrested for Possession of Firearms by Certain Persons (convicted felon) and transported to the Detention Center.  He remains incarcerated in lieu of $15,000 bond, with a court appearance set for September 5th.
